'I think he would make a good captain' - fans on Gueye future
[BBC] [Getty Images] We asked for your views on whether Idrissa Gana Gueye should stay at Everton after the club confirmed talks are ongoing with the midfielder. Here are some of your comments: Anton: I wouldn't be actively looking to lose players from an already-thin squad,but it mostly depends on what game-time Gueye is looking for. He's not getting any younger but, if he feels he can still start the majority of matches, then a decision needs to be made, especially if we can (should) bring in Hayden Hackney to partner James Garner. Gueye's been a very good servant over his two spells and his experience is important, but maybe it could be time to thank him and move on. Colin: He's playing well, that's all that matters. He was a mainstay last season and has a role to play next season. Chris: Need a bigger squad anyway so give him another year - it's a no brainer. He might not be a starter but we need more options. Steve: We should keep Gueye for another year. We missed him so much when he left. Give Tim Iroegbunam the chance to grow as his replacement. Also, why are we letting Roman Dixon leave when we need a right back and that is where he plays? Get the recruitment strategy sorted! Marko: In regards to Idrissa Gueye renewing his contract with Everton FC, as one of the most experienced and capable players in the squad I would like to see him extend his stay. I think he would make a good captain for this season at least. Phil: If we can buy Hackney and another young midfielder, no. Jeff: Everton should have never taken him back and now they should not give him a new contract. We need to rebuild the team with young players who are an example for all our fans.
